The move comes after Jaguars owner Shad Khan initially appeared to back Baalke to lead the search for a new head coach, but the team confirmed the news that Baalke was out after four years in Duval on Wednesday.
"Following several discussions with Trent Baalke this week, we both arrived at the conclusion that it is in our mutual best interests to respectfully separate, effective immediately," Khan said in a statement.
The Jags had a 25-43 record during Baalke’s tenure, with the timing of his exit raising eyebrows across the league, given it came hours after Tampa Bay Buccaneers offensive coordinator Liam Coen withdrew himself from consideration for the head coach job in Jacksonville.
The Jags also interviewed Ben Johnson and Aaron Glenn for the post this month, only to see the pair join the Chicago Bears and New York Jets respectively.
The franchise has scheduled second interviews with former Jets head coach Robert Saleh and Raiders defensive coordinator Patrick Graham, but will now also have to begin the search for a new general manager.
Khan added: “Ethan Waugh will serve as interim general manager and play an important role, with others, as we continue the process of interviewing candidates to serve as our new head coach.
"I am deeply committed to building a winner here in Jacksonville and look forward to introducing a new head coach who will make that happen for our players and fans alike.”
